"The Enemy is Words, Words, Words'

Thanks to Dave Lull for passing along a link to this interview with the great poet Samuel Menashe at Nextbook. Here's a sample:

"The enemy is words, words, words. I struggle—it’s a kind of perfectionism. I’ll work on a poem the whole summer, and by the end, it will have three lines less. I’ll even take out words from poems that have already appeared in books. Somebody once met me at a party and when I sent him a poem, he couldn’t believe the contrast between my voluble talking—or being articulate if you want to put it more nicely—and the voice of my poetry."
